A smart contract is a computerized transaction protocol that executes the terms of a contract
What are Smart Contracts on Blockchain
Smart contracts refer to digital agreements stored within a blockchain with preset terms and conditions.
The smart contracts will be implemented and executed once these terms and conditions are met.
The automation of the terms and conditions ensures that the participants immediately become certain of the outcome.
Since smart contracts help to automate the workflow they play an important role in saving time and also determining the condition upon which the next trigger should be met.
Some technologies that exist today can be considered as crude smart contracts, for example POS terminals and cards, EDI, and agoric allocation of public network bandwidth.
by Nick Szabo
The concept of smart contracts came into being around the 1990s from the computer scientist, Nick Szabo. He entered the arrangement of self-executing the arrangement within the computer protocols. These protocols further worked together to meet the predetermined conditions. As a result, the concept and learning were further brought into being in 2008 with blockchain technology.
Smart contracts execute themselves and are stored in the blockchain, a digitally secure ledger. The smart contracts will provide the result depending on the command it receives. The terms and conditions need to be coded into it. Only when these predetermined conditions are met, the contract will execute on its own. As a result, it helps to get rid of any third party, thereby fostering transparency and trust.
Smart contracts in blockchain are of three types, these include:
Also Read: What is Bitcoin Halving and How Is It Done?
Implementing smart contracts on blockchain can offer a wide range of advantages which can be used by businesses across different sectors. Some of these major ones include the following:
In regards to smart contracts on the blockchain, there is no involvement of any third party, and the data is encrypted. When the encrypted data is shared with all participants, there is complete assurance and transparency that none of the data has been altered by any of the participants.
Unlike other conditions, smart contracts are pretty fast and efficient. For example, as soon as the terms and conditions are met, smart contracts will be executed immediately. Moreover, smart contracts are completely digital eliminating any requirement of paper documents further speeding up the process. Thus, there wouldn’t be any risk of manual errors in the document as well, which usually happens in the case of paper documents.
As suggested, the smart contracts on the blockchain are encrypted, making them highly secure. All the transactions will be encrypted, thereby making it difficult for a callback or any alterations to further secure it. Moreover, every record on these smart contracts is interconnected with a series of records, making it difficult for hackers to alter. Even if these hackers want to make any alterations, they will have to change the entire chain for one data point.
There is no involvement of any third party in the case of smart contracts, which removes the requirement of paying any additional intermediaries. As a result, it helps to avoid any unnecessary charges and time delays.
Also Read: What is a crypto trading bot and how does it work?
With smart contracts on blockchain offering a wide range of advantages, several industries have adopted it. Most of them are keeping up with these to implement transparency and security across different platforms.
Thus, some of the major industries that have adopted smart contracts on blockchain are as follows:
The implementation of smart contracts on blockchain has proven to be extremely efficient, especially in terms of making international trade faster and more efficient. Businesses are creating a system of trust and using standardised rules and systems, especially in terms of simplifying the function. This helps businesses explore various trade opportunities and thereby participate in different companies and banks.
The medical industry is also using smart contracts on blockchain on an advanced level, especially in regards to improving efficiency. They’re helping to improve the supply chain technology of temperature-controlled pharmaceuticals that offer speed of service. Thus, smart contracts also help to boost trust and reliability while leveraging the accuracy of data.
Smart contracts in blockchain have been helping to increase trust in the retailer supplier industry. It helps to boost real-time communication, thereby increasing visibility across the supplier channel. This further plays an important role in boosting productivity and bringing efficiency for innovation, offering extensive benefits.
Smart contracts across blockchain have proven to be extremely beneficial, especially in regards to boosting business. It is advisable to implement the same, depending on business needs. Furthermore, it is important to understand the business requirements and how smart contracts can be included in the business ecosystem, thereby offering efficiency.
What is Bitcoin Mining and How Does It Work?
This post was last modified on May 8, 2024 1:33 am
Rish Gupta is an Indian entrepreneur who serves as the chief executive officer (CEO) of…
Are you looking to advance your engineering career in the field of robotics? Check out…
Artificial intelligence is a topic that has recently made internet users all over the world…
Boost your learning journey with the power of AI communities. The article below highlights the…
Demystify the world of Artificial Intelligence with our comprehensive AI Glossary and Terminologies Cheat Sheet.…
Scott Wu is the co-founder and Chief Executive Officer of Cognition Labs, an artificial intelligence…